Bad Tor Nodes
The Tor network is made up of a series of nodes, which are essentially servers that relay traffic. While the vast majority of these nodes are operated by volunteers, there are also some bad actors who operate malicious nodes in order to spy on users or inject malware.
Unfortunately, because the Tor network is designed to be anonymous, it can be very difficult to identify and track down these bad actors. However, law enforcement agencies have become increasingly skilled at doing so, and they have even managed to shut down some major malicious nodes in recent years.
If you are using the Tor network, it is important to be aware of the risks posed by these bad actors. You should only use trusted nodes, and you should be careful about what information you share over the network.
